
You can take Cetico 10mg Tablet with or without food. The dosage may vary based on your specific condition, so always follow your doctor's advice. It is often recommended to take this medicine in the evening. You may only need to take Cetico 10mg Tablet when you experience symptoms, but if you're taking it to prevent symptoms, consistent daily use is advised. Missing doses or stopping treatment early may lead to your symptoms returning.
Cetico 10mg Tablet is generally considered very safe. Common side effects may include sleepiness, dizziness, tiredness, and a sore throat. These are usually mild and tend to resolve as your body adjusts to the medication. If any side effects persist or become bothersome, consult your doctor. It is advisable to avoid alcohol while taking this medicine.
Before starting Cetico 10mg Tablet, inform your doctor if you have kidney problems or epilepsy, as your dosage might need adjustment or the medicine may not be suitable. Please tell your healthcare team about all other medications you are taking, as some can interact with Cetirizine 10mg. If you are pregnant or breastfeeding, discuss with your doctor before using this medicine, although it is not generally considered harmful.
